Merge recent vendor changes:
3100 zvol rename fails with EBUSY when dirty 3104 eliminate empty bpobjs 3120 zinject hangs in zfsdev_ioctl() due to uninitialized zc References: https://www.illumos.org/issues/3100 https://www.illumos.org/issues/3104 https://www.illumos.org/issues/3120 Obtained from: illumos (vendor/illumos, vendor/illumos-sys) MFC after: 2 weeks

+20120828:
+ A new ZFS feature flag "com.delphix:empty_bpobj" has been merged
+ to -HEAD. Pools that have empty_bpobj in active state can not be
+ imported read-write with ZFS implementations that do not support
+ this feature. For more information read the zpool-features(5)
+ manual page.

+This feature increases the performance of creating and using a large number
+of snapshots of a single filesystem or volume, and also reduces the disk
+space required.
+.Pp
+When there are many snapshots, each snapshot uses many Block Pointer Objects
+.Pq bpobj's
+to track blocks associated with that snapshot.
+However, in common use cases, most of these bpobj's are empty.
+This feature allows us to create each bpobj on-demand, thus eliminating the
+empty bpobjs.
+.Pp
+This feature is
+.Sy active
+while there are any filesystems, volumes, or snapshots which were created
+after enabling this feature.
